What is Audiobus?Audiobus is an award-winning music app for iPhone and iPad which lets you use your other music apps together. Chain effects on your favourite synth, run the output of apps or Audio Units into an app like GarageBand or Loopy, or select a different audio interface output for each app. Route MIDI between apps — drive a synth from a MIDI sequencer, or add an arpeggiator to your MIDI keyboard — or sync with your external MIDI gear. And control your entire setup from a MIDI controller.

Many of the members of the AudioBus Forum community, who use and generally love Korg Gadget, have supported the idea of voting on a "BIG THREE" list of improvements we'd like to see Korg make to Gadget asap.

Korg have stated that they have a roadmap to further perfect the system as a mobile music production studio - so the idea is to voice the BIG THREE issues that audiobus members have voted as being the things they'd like Korg to focus on.

There's a lot of user knowledge, not to mention spending power, in this community so we hope Korg will listen.

The shortlisted issues have been gleaned from a thread that has run this week collecting views.
